
Friends of Felines is dedicated to providing vital services to felines and their human companions throughout the Willamette Valley. We are a large, passionate group of individuals committed to the welfare of cats and people in our community.
Our journey began in 2004 when a handful of local, animal-loving volunteers recognized a significant need for more support for cats in the Salem area. What started with just a few foster homes has grown into a regional leader in feline welfare, driven by a commitment to compassion, education, and community.
In February 2021, we proudly moved into our permanent 5,000 square-foot home in Keizer, Oregon. Our facility allows us to provide more comprehensive care than ever before, featuring an adoption center, a fully equipped surgery suite, and a wellness clinic. We operate as a limited-admission rescue, blending the comfort of volunteer foster homes with our professional on-site amenities to give every cat the best start.
